/**
|
||||
* Returns the hostname for a referrer string (URL or plain hostname), or null if invalid.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
function getReferrerHostname(referrer: string): string | null {
|
||||
if (!referrer || typeof referrer !== 'string') return null
|
||||
const trimmed = referrer.trim()
|
||||
if (REFERRER_NO_FAVICON.includes(trimmed.toLowerCase())) return null
|
||||
try {
|
||||
const url = new URL(trimmed.startsWith('http') ? trimmed : `https://${trimmed}`)
|
||||
return url.hostname.toLowerCase()
|
||||
} catch {
|
||||
return null
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* Returns a friendly display name for the referrer (e.g. "Google" instead of "google.com").
|
||||
* Falls back to the original referrer string when no mapping exists.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
export function getReferrerDisplayName(referrer: string): string {
|
||||
if (!referrer || typeof referrer !== 'string') return referrer || ''
|
||||
const trimmed = referrer.trim()
|
||||
if (trimmed === '') return ''
|
||||
const hostname = getReferrerHostname(trimmed)
|
||||
if (!hostname) return trimmed
|
||||
const displayName = REFERRER_DISPLAY_NAMES[hostname]
|
||||
if (displayName) return displayName
|
||||
return trimmed
|
||||
}
